OU Health is the state’s only comprehensive academic health system of hospitals, clinics and centers of excellence. With 11,000 employees and more than 1,300 physicians and advanced practice providers, OU Health is home to Oklahoma’s largest doctor network with a complete range of specialty care. OU Health serves Oklahoma and the region with the state’s only freestanding children’s hospital, the only National Cancer Institute-Designated OU Health Stephenson Cancer Center, Oklahoma’s flagship hospital, which serves as the state’s only Level 1 trauma center and Edmond Medical Center in the heart of the Edmond Community. Becker’s Hospital Review named University of Oklahoma Medical Center one of the 100 Great Hospitals in America for 2020. OU Health’s oncology program at OU Health Stephenson Cancer Center was named Oklahoma’s top facility for cancer care by U.S. News & World Report in its 2020-21 rankings. OU Health also was ranked by U.S. News & World Report as high performing in these specialties: Colon Surgery, COPD and Congestive Heart Failure. Requirements

  •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) or Master of Social Work (MSW) from an accredited institution is required.
  • At least 5 years of progressive leadership experience with at least 3 years of care management experience required.
  • Current RN License issued by the Oklahoma State Board of Nursing or a current multistate compact RN License (eNLC) or Current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) from the Oklahoma State Board of Licensed Social Workers required.
